Understanding Game Strategies

When it comes to gaming strategies, different games require different approaches. For instance, while luck plays a major role in slot machines, games like poker and blackjack involve a significant level of skill and strategy. Understanding the rules and strategies specific to each game can greatly increase the chances of winning. Players often develop their strategies through experience, research, or even by studying professional players. Familiarity with the game’s dynamics, such as when to bet aggressively or fold, is essential.

Additionally, strategies can often be categorized into two main types: aggressive and conservative. Aggressive strategies involve taking higher risks in hopes of achieving greater rewards, while conservative strategies focus on minimizing losses and ensuring longevity in play. Choosing the right approach depends on individual player psychology, risk tolerance, and overall goals. For example, someone looking to have fun might adopt a more aggressive approach, while a player seeking to win money might prefer a conservative strategy.

Moreover, leveraging statistical analysis can greatly enhance a player’s strategic approach. Understanding probabilities, odds, and payout structures allows players to make more informed decisions. For instance, a player in blackjack might learn when to double down or split based on the dealer’s visible card. Knowledge of game-specific strategies combined with probability can lead to a more strategic, informed, and ultimately successful gaming experience.

The Role of Probability in Gambling

Probability is at the core of all casino games, determining the likelihood of various outcomes. Each game operates on a set of defined probabilities that dictate how often certain results will occur, which ultimately influences the potential for winning or losing. For example, in roulette, the odds of landing on a specific number are relatively low, which is why the payouts for such bets are typically high. Understanding these probabilities is vital for any player who wishes to maximize their chances of success.

In addition to understanding individual game probabilities, players should also consider the concept of variance. Variance refers to the risk involved in gambling, which can manifest as swings in a player’s bankroll. High variance games, such as slots, can offer big wins but also lead to substantial losses. Conversely, low variance games, like certain table games, provide more consistent, smaller wins. Understanding variance helps players manage their expectations and develop appropriate betting strategies.

Players can also employ probability theory to identify patterns and trends in games, although it’s important to remember that gambling is inherently unpredictable. The law of large numbers suggests that over a large number of bets, the actual outcome will converge towards the expected outcome. This can give players a false sense of security; however, the outcomes of individual sessions can still be wildly unpredictable. A solid understanding of probability allows players to navigate this uncertainty effectively.

The Psychological Aspects of Gambling

The psychology of gambling significantly affects player behavior and decision-making. Factors such as excitement, anticipation, and even the fear of loss play pivotal roles in how players interact with games. Many players experience a dopamine rush when they win, which can lead to addictive behaviors. Understanding these psychological triggers is crucial for responsible gambling, enabling players to recognize when their emotions may cloud their judgment.

Cognitive biases also heavily influence gambling behavior. For example, the illusion of control leads players to believe they can influence the outcome of random events, such as the spin of a slot machine or the roll of dice. This belief can lead to increased betting and potential losses. Additionally, the gambler’s fallacy—believing that past outcomes affect future results—can further complicate a player’s decision-making process. Being aware of these cognitive biases can help players approach gambling in a more rational and controlled manner.

Lastly, the social dynamics of gambling, particularly in physical casinos, can amplify emotional responses. The atmosphere of excitement, camaraderie, and competition can lead to impulsive decisions. Players may find themselves betting more than they initially planned or chasing losses in an attempt to regain a perceived control. Developing self-awareness about these social influences can aid players in making more calculated decisions, allowing for a more enjoyable and responsible gambling experience.
